<ARTICLE>                     5
<MULTIPLIER>                                   1,000
       
                             
<PERIOD-TYPE>                   9-MOS
<FISCAL-YEAR-END>                             JAN-31-1997 
<PERIOD-START>                                FEB-01-1996  
<PERIOD-END>                                  OCT-31-1996  
<CASH>                                        12,875        
<SECURITIES>                                       0        
<RECEIVABLES>                                 15,964        
<ALLOWANCES>                                     915        
<INVENTORY>                                    4,003        
<CURRENT-ASSETS>                              32,310        
<PP&E>                                         4,484        
<DEPRECIATION>                                 3,251        
<TOTAL-ASSETS>                                33,676        
<CURRENT-LIABILITIES>                         16,603        
<BONDS>                                            0        
<PREFERRED-MANDATORY>                              0        
<PREFERRED>                                        0        
<COMMON>                                      50,155        
<OTHER-SE>                                   (33,562)      
<TOTAL-LIABILITY-AND-EQUITY>                  33,676        
<SALES>                                       31,541        
<TOTAL-REVENUES>                              31,541        
<CGS>                                         20,472        
<TOTAL-COSTS>                                 20,472        
<OTHER-EXPENSES>                               9,849        
<LOSS-PROVISION>                                 163        
<INTEREST-EXPENSE>                               374        
<INCOME-PRETAX>                                1,307       
<INCOME-TAX>                                       0        
<INCOME-CONTINUING>                            1,307       
<DISCONTINUED>                                     0        
<EXTRAORDINARY>                                    0        
<CHANGES>                                          0        
<NET-INCOME>                                   1,307       
<EPS-PRIMARY>                                   0.13     
<EPS-DILUTED>                                   0.12